Please can someone help ?

I have an ancestor born 1905 who needs all temple ordinances.

I have tried to request the ordinances, but it shows me a notice saying that I need permission because the person was born within the last 110 years....but my ancestor was born in 1905 which is 116 years ago.

How do I get this issue resolved with there now being no operative telphone number for England, UK ?

    The Sealing to Spouse is still showing 'needs permission' because there is no birth date. The record just shows deceased so the system can't assume he was born more that 110 years ago.

    If we had the name and the ID number of this ancestor, born 1905, we could look it up and see what the problem is. Most likely, you can request all of the individual ordinances for this person, but perhaps this ancestor has a marriage to another person who is not as old, and that SS ordinance needs permission. Go to the person page for this ancestor, and look at the ordinances there.
